Output 93d4cd266904cfd32f7ccf1c5d68a5dd9b8187ce8d54d7d5f19afcc6ec3096a0:0

value
298882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d2b3cf105bfd89351d95c165fb5587bf2e1f16 OP_EQUAL
address
3Ez4KDYTA3DVR9SdpHiHD6hMKGVhxov8Sk
transaction
93d4cd266904cfd32f7ccf1c5d68a5dd9b8187ce8d54d7d5f19afcc6ec3096a0
spent
true